Richard qualified at Guy’s Dental school in 1993, and remained on the staff there for eighteen months post graduate. He developed strong interest in dental implantology early on and was lucky to attend the Brånemark Institute in Gothenburg, Sweden, culminating in him being the first in the UK to perform ‘teeth in a day’- the predecessor to ‘All on Four’ implant replacement approach. He first worked on an occasional basis at St Faiths as an Oral Surgeon from July 1999, increasing his commitment exponentially since- ultimately buying the practice in 2015 with Susanne, his wife, and building it up into the thriving regional multidisciplinary dental referral centre it is today. He also spent many years in prestigious West End practice in London covering the full range of dental specialities, but these days he works exclusively at St Faiths and largely confines the treatment he provides to Oral Surgery and Dental Implantology, which he says keeps him entertained. He first lived in East Grinstead back in 1996 during his post graduate training at the Queen Victoria Hospital and loved the area so much he moved back with his young family in 2004. Outside of work, he pursues a passion – correction – obsession! for weird old vehicles, his collection ranging in size from a 1962 Messerschmitt KR200 ‘bubble car’ up to a 1961 Routemaster London bus. His current favourites are a very rare 1967 ‘Amphicar’ (‘a terrible car and an even worse boat’) and a very grumpy 1904 Stanley Steamer which he recently successfully campaigned in the London to Brighton Veteran Car Run.
